Starting and keeping small businesses going

Some public officials in West Virginia have understood for years that we need to expand and diversify our economy -- and that maybe the best way to do that is to start small. Efforts to help people start and sustain small businesses here have strengthened to the degree that a study conducted by Franchise Opportunities has named the Mountain State the leading state for new business survival. That's a big deal. Plenty of small business owners will tell you it is easier to start one than to keep one going. Franchise Opportunities chose a five-year period that included the Covid-19 ...

Opportunities may determine state’s hard-working rankings

WalletHub recently produced its “Hardest-Working States in America (2026)” report. Readers in West Virginia and Appalachian Ohio are likely thinking “Finally! A report in which our region will not be dead last.” About that … Both the Mountain and Buckeye states fall in the bottom ten, which WalletHub labels “least hardworking.” West Virginia is 42nd, Ohio is 47th – those same residents will be pleased to note that ranks above Michigan, which did, indeed, come in dead last. This study looked at direct work factors, including metrics such as average workweek hours, ...

No fun to be found in W.Va.?

Most of us are proud of the state where we live for many reasons (and not so proud for others). But we don't usually tend to think of our home territory as "fun" as compared with other places. California, for example, is ranked the most fun state in WalletHub's "Most Fun States in America (2026)." Florida is second. It's hard not to wonder whether a certain mouse has something to do with that. West Virginia ... well, we know by now how this goes. According to the researchers at WalletHub, the Mountain State is the LEAST fun in the country -- 49th for entertainment and recreation, and ...
